Unveiling the Strategic Role of 5-Bromoacetyl Salicylamide in Modern Pharmaceutical and Chemical Applications Under Intensifying Market Dynamics

5-Bromoacetyl Salicylamide occupies a vital niche at the intersection of chemical synthesis and pharmaceutical innovation, distinguished by its unique molecular structure that combines halogenation with acetyl and salicylamide functionalities. This compound serves as a cornerstone for advanced research applications, providing enhanced reactivity profiles that facilitate the development of novel therapeutic and diagnostic agents. Its dual role as both a chemical intermediate and an analytical reagent underscores its versatility, positioning it as a critical input within multiple stages of drug discovery and quality control workflows.

Against a backdrop of accelerating technological advancements and evolving regulatory frameworks, stakeholders are increasingly recognizing the strategic importance of 5-Bromoacetyl Salicylamide. Its capacity to enable precise trace analysis and to act as a robust scaffold for medicinal chemistry initiatives has heightened demand across laboratories and manufacturing facilities. Navigating Complex Segmentation Dimensions to Reveal Critical Insights Across Applications, Grades, Product Forms, End Users, and Distribution Channels

Insight into the 5-Bromoacetyl Salicylamide market emerges most vividly when examining how different segmentation folds interact to influence demand and pricing. Across applications, demand from analytical testing often centers on quality control protocols and trace analysis procedures that require stringent purity standards, while chemical intermediate usage prioritizes scalability and yield in multi-step syntheses. Pharmaceutical manufacturing reveals a bifurcation between clinical and preclinical stages, with early-stage therapeutic research demanding smaller, highly controlled batches tailored to anti-inflammatory, cardiovascular, and pain management pipelines. R&D investments, split between applied and basic research initiatives, further underscore the compound’s versatility as a building block for novel molecular targets.

Purity grade preferences also shape market dynamics. Analytical grade material commands premium pricing, serving laboratories with the strictest contaminant thresholds. Pharma grade sits at the nexus of regulatory compliance and cost efficiency, whereas technical grade fulfills bulk requirements in non-regulated chemical processes. Product form considerations add another layer of complexity: granules offer ease of handling for bulk synthesis, liquids facilitate continuous flow systems, and powders deliver flexibility for both small-scale research and large-scale production. End-user segmentation paints a portrait of diverse purchasing behaviors: academic labs prioritize method validation; contract research organizations demand rapid delivery and traceability; pharmaceutical companies emphasize quality certifications; and research institutes seek adaptable quantities. Finally, distribution channels range from direct sales, which ensure intimate customer support, through authorized and third-party distributors that extend regional reach, to e-commerce platforms and manufacturer websites offering streamlined procurement pathways.
